Transaction 393261a58c89e51c743d7eb0c731e0c2e9e348b665c186c10e1a86c8e536f823
1 Input
1 Output
-
393261a58c89e51c743d7eb0c731e0c2e9e348b665c186c10e1a86c8e536f823:0
- value
- 899648859
- script pubkey
- OP_0 OP_PUSHBYTES_20 f23a1a63102797493dd9b322c2d6c686e1c48088
- address
- bc1q7gap5ccsy7t5j0wekv3v94kxsmsufqygh3p8p9